Quick note for the security review of the Pondworks admin dashboard: dark mode isn't just CSS — theme preference is stored server-side per user, and the toggle endpoint is authenticated but was unthrottled until last month. We fixed that, plus a minor issue where theme assets were fetched over a legacy path that skipped the CDN auth header. Both patches are merged. The threat-model writeup and the diff summary are collected on the internal review page below.

dashboard of tahaf-yagug = https://sonarqube.norvaio.local/secrets/pages/run/board/b985e578b12af9af

## PR #412: Cursor-Based Pagination for the Plover Public API

This change migrates /v2/orders from offset pagination to keyset cursors. For new folks: offsets caused skipped rows when records were deleted mid-scan, and deep pages hammered the Harrowfield replicas. Cursors are base64-encoded keyset tokens, validated server-side. Backward compatibility is kept for one release. The defaults introduced here are:

tuning table, yajog-yahof:
BUDGETS = {
    "lamvan": 303,
    "wenox": 460,
    "fenvan": 525,
}

## Authentication

Migratron performs zero-downtime schema migrations for the Corvella platform. Before running any migration plan, the CLI must authenticate against the internal SchemaPort service; support staff should use the shared operations credential rather than personal tokens. Set it via the MIGRATRON_TOKEN environment variable. The current key is below.

app token of yajop-tawif = kto3_vib

## Spokewise Environments

Spokewise, our bike-share rebalancing tool, runs in three environments: dev, staging, and prod. Dev uses synthetic dock data; staging mirrors prod with a one-hour delay. Contractors get access to dev and staging only. Each environment reads its settings from a mounted config volume at boot. For reference, the staging environment currently uses the following values.

config for kagup-hahig:
druwyn:
  pin: 2801
  metrics_host: metrics.druwyn.zemvarlabs.internal
  tenant: sorius
  seal: seal_798a43d7